Painters Caulk
Technical Data Sheet
1.
DESCRIPTION
Antel
Painters Caulk is an easy to apply waterborne permanent flexible
acrylic emulsion sealant which provides and efficient seal between
materials where slight movement is likely to occur.
It is based on a durable pure acrylic emulsion processed
with a high level of both wet and dry state fungicides making it
suitable for both internal and external decorative sealing.
External use is permissible provided that the weather
conditions are likely to allow the development of a substantial
skin before exposure to rain.
It can be over coated with both alkyd resin and water based
paints.
2.
USES
Typical
interior uses :-
Sealing
gaps around window and door frames.
Sealing
up to skirting boards and covings.
Gives
flexible seals to cracks in plaster.
It
can be over coated with wall coverings as well as over painted,
making it a versatile decorating aid.
Typical
exterior uses :-
Sealing
low to medium movement construction joints between brick,
concrete, timber etc.
Sealing
joints in timber frame constructions
sealant
for perimeter pointing around doors and windows.
It
can be applied to surfaces which are damp and will remain flexible
long after traditional oil based mastics have failed.

7.
APPLICATION
All
surfaces should be dry, clean and free from grease before
application. Wood,
plaster and brick may be damp but not running wet.
Use mechanical abrasion to clean porous surfaces before
application.
For
extra performance in movement situations a primer can be prepared
by diluting one part Antel Painters Caulk with two parts water,
and mixing thoroughly. The
primer should then be brush applied and allowed to dry for two to
three hours before applying the Painters Caulk.
Alternatively Antel P V A Bonding Agent may be used on the
surface.
For
internal cracks in plaster the shoulders of the crack should be
widened to a minimum of 3 - 4 mm to ensure adequate penetration
and performance. For
internal sealing around doors, window frames and skirting boards a
6 mm fillet is recommended. For
external pointing of door and window frames the fillet face should
be a minimum of 12 mm across with a minimum depth of 6 mm of
sealant.
Prepare
the joint by cleaning and priming if necessary.
Cut the nozzle to the desired angle and gun firmly into the
joint to give a good solid fill.
Strike off the sealant flush with the joint sides within
five minutes of application before skinning occurs.
A small amount of shrinkage will occur on curing.
If a flush finish is required fill the joint slightly proud
of the surface to allow for shrinkage.

Tack
free time 15 - 60 minutes dependent on thickness, temperature and
humidity.
Full
cure 3 - 5 days dependent on thickness, temperature and humidity.
